Buying a home can be a most exciting experience and can be stressful as well. You have to spend a lot of your time and effort searching for homes. To avoid home buying stress, find a professional real estate agent and have a preparation.

Save time by hiring an agent, he or she will do the research for you and will help you right through the whole process. You can ask questions on the things do not understand concerning real estate property.

Have a copy of your credit report before going to a lender for mortgage so you can make corrections and improve your credits. If your credit comes out to be in good figure, then you are now ready to meet with your lender.

]]>

Most of the sellers do not accept any offer without a pre approval from a lender. This will tell you how much you can afford, monthly payment and your expected closing costs. It is better if you talk with other lenders before deciding so you can evaluate rates and the closing costs.

When your lender already told you how much home you can really afford, you have to make your mind up if you want to spend much with extra expenses such as repairs, buying furniture, and home maintenance.

When searching a home, make a shopping list to make you stay organized.

Most transactions takes about a month from the time the home is set under contract.

Get a licensed home inspector to check the condition of the property before purchasing. You will be able to find out the condition of the property and you can discuss about the repairs or agree for a price decrease

Have one last look at the home you buy to make sure it is in good condition. Before closing, it is better to find out if there are any concerns with the property so will still have time to fix some problems.

When you are selling your home, it is important to get it ready before the first potential buyer walks through your door. Your real estate agent should have a list of home selling tips that you can use to make your house more attractive to buyers. Doing things like removing clutter and cleaning up the yard are among the easy and inexpensive tasks you can do that will make a big difference in your house’s appearance.

Getting rid of the clutter in your house is one of the most important steps you can take towards selling your home. Having excess stuff in your house makes it difficult for potential buyers to get a clear picture of the house. They will be so busy trying to filter out your clutter that they will not be able to see themselves in the home. Organizing closets, keeping toys picked up, and boxing up knick knacks are just a few of the things you can do to remove some of the clutter. If you have no way of neatly storing these items, consider putting a few things in a storage unit.

]]>

Ranked right up there with clutter on any home selling tips list is depersonalizing your home. You need to put away personal photographs and heirlooms. Leaving them up is a distraction for people who are viewing your house, preventing them from picturing their own personal touches.

Keeping your yard, front and back, well manicured is a necessity. Even if you have a beautiful home, people will not go inside and look at it if they are turned off by an overgrown, junk filled yard. Make sure your grass is cut and not overgrown with weeds. Pick up any toys the kids may have left in the yard. Trim your hedges if they look overgrown.

Clean your house from top to bottom and keep it that way. A clean house is more attractive to new home buyers. It lets them know the house is well maintained. Get rid of any cobwebs and dust. Wash both the inside and outside of your windows and clean the floors. Once you have given it a thorough cleaning it will be easy to maintain throughout the selling process.

Using a list of home selling tips to get you and your house ready for the selling process is a great way to ensure that your house is marketable. It will allow potential buyers to picture themselves and their belongings in the house. It will also show that you have cared for and properly maintained your house.

The Teacher Next Door Program (TND)also known as the Good Neighbor Next Door Program (GNND) is a HUD homes special program open to not only teachers, but also police officers, firefighters and emergency medical technicians (EMT).  To get started and for qualifying purposes there are three things you need to know about HUD houses and the HUD Good Neighbor Next Door Program (GNND) 50% off discount:

Each participant is defined as follows:

A teacher is defined as an individual who is employed full time by a public or private school or educational agency. Holds a current State-level certification, as a classroom teacher or educational administrator (Principal, Assistant Principal, etc) in grades K through 12.  And in good standing with the employer.

Substitute teachers who are employed full-time (every day) on an on-going, full-time, contract (standard teaching contracts are generally for 180 school days a year, or more) with a school system. These are employees who simply work in a different school every day or for short periods in the same school.

Teachers have to buy property in the same school system where they teach – or in the case of a private school, within the radius where the school draws the students.

A Law Enforcement Officer, for purposes of this program, is defined as an individual who is employed full-time by a Federal, State, county, or municipal government and is sworn to uphold, and make arrests for violations of, Federal, State, County, or municipal law and is in

good standing with the department.

Firefighters and EMTs must be employed full-time as a firefighter or emergency medical technician by a fire department or emergency medical services responder unit of the federal government, a state, unit of general local government, or an Indian tribal government serving the area where the home is located.

All participants will have to agree execute a second mortgage and note that will be for the amount of 50% of the purchase price. In other words, if a home is purchased with a list price of 0,000, there will be a second mortgage on the house that has NO monthly payment but will be recorded as a lien against the property for three years.

]]>

The occupancy restriction for program participants who purchase HUD homes is that they must occupy the property as their primary residence for three years beginning on the date of the closing documents. During the entire three year term, participants may not own any other residential real property.

If someone currently owns real property, it must be sold before closing on a GNND property.

Participants may be required to recertify each year to verify occupancy and compliance.

Once the three year residency period has passed, the second mortgage (lien against the property) is released.

If for some reason you must move or sell the home before the end of the required three year period, you must repay 90% of the second mortgage during the first year, 60% during the second year, 30% during the third year and at the end of the three year period the mortgage is forgiven.

The second mortgage is not calculated in the monthly payment.  The second mortgage is a silent second and requires no repayment with full program compliance.

The first mortgage on the property which will have a monthly payment will typically include more than just the other 50% of the list price. Closing costs, commissions & renovations can be financed in with the purchase amount.

For example, a property with a 0,000 list price has a ,000 silent second mortgage and a ,000 first mortgage with monthly payments due.  If the purchaser does not have closing costs needed in cash, this amount may be added to the first mortgage.  HUD does not pay any of a GNND participants closing costs since the home is being sold at a 50% discount. All closing costs will be calculated based on the list price, not the discounted mortgage amount. HUD homes allows sales commission of up to five percent so a five percent commission paid on the purchase of a HUD home in this example would be 5% of 0,000 or ,000.  Closing costs such as lender fees, transfer charges, and settlement expenses might equal ,000.  The property may need ,000 in renovations since it’s being sold as-is.  HUD houses are always sold as-is.

The first mortgage on the referenced property would be a total of ,000 (,000 discounted price plus ,000 commission plus ,000 rehab). And the monthly payment would be calculated with the approximate loan amount of ,000. That would make the realized discount on the property listed at 0,000 an 83% discount, but it’s important to note that the discount is taken from the as-is value of the home.  After improvements have been completed, the home’s value would increase as well.  The increase in value may be more or less than the actual cost of the renovations, but definitely more than the as-is value.  The discount would have to be calculated based on the after-repair value.

The TND/GNND Program has additional specific requirements that must be met by program participants in order to purchase HUD homes at a 50% discount.

According to the latest review on housing (one of many!) the OFT claim “A shake-up in how homes are sold, including updating legislation to allow new entrants into the market, could lead to a better deal for house buyers and sellers”.

Their main reason for this thought appears to be because the “housing market remains dominated by traditional estate agents with weak competition between them on price. As property prices rise during housing booms, so too do estate agents’ fees.”

It’s an interesting conclusion and having worked in this market for over 20 years, my experience of estate agent competition is that it’s quite intense. UK agents also charge a much lower commission than their overseas counterparts. So how exactly is the OFT claiming ‘weak competition’ on price and backing up the suggestion that selling through an agent is an ‘expensive’ process?

The good news from the Office of Fair Trading though is that apparently “overall satisfaction with estate agents, however, has improved in recent years” and it appears buyers and sellers are beginning to realise that many of the problems during the buying and selling process are more to do with the legals and other people in the chain as opposed to ‘everything’ being the agent’s fault.

]]>

As this sector has received a lot of legal and regulatory changes, the OFT concluded that “existing legislation….is comprehensive and wide ranging….and that further regulation is unnecessary…The focus should be on enforcement of current rules to guard against serious breaches.”

The OFT go on to conclude that “innovation in this sector, in particular through online services, could have a dramatic impact on the cost of buying and selling a home”. This might be true, but one of the issues is that a huge amount of money has been poured into private sales websites in the last 10 years. The only ones that have really worked are estate agents that have embraced the net and offered ‘advertising only’ packages through to the full service.

In summary, the key changes that the report seems to be suggesting are:-

1. ”Additional rules….. around fees received by estate agents for referring buyers to providers of ancillary services such as mortgage advice, surveys, and conveyancing”

2. ”Encouraging new business models, online estate agents and private seller platforms”.

3. Recommending more people negotiate on commissions paid to estate agents, as according to their research, “64% of sellers in England and Wales did not negotiate a lower fee”.

The people of ‘Ad lived many years in the windswept hills of an area between Yemen and Oman. They were physically well built and renowned for their craftsmanship especially in the construction of tall buildings with lofty towers. They were outstanding among all the nations in power and wealth, which, unfortunately, made them arrogant and boastful. Their political power was held in the hand of unjust rulers, against whom no one dared to raise a voice.

They were not ignorant of the existence of Allah, nor did they refuse to worship Him. What they did refuse was to worship Allah alone. They worshipped other gods, also, including idols. This is one sin Allah does not forgive.

Allah wanted to guide and discipline these people so He sent a prophet from among them. This prophet was Hud (PBUH), a noble man who handled this task with great resoluteness and tolerance.

Ibn Jarir reported that he was Hud Ibn Shalikh, Ibn Arfakhshand, Ibn Sam, Ibn Noah (PBUH). He also reported that Prophet Hud (PBUH) was from a tribe called Ad Ibn Us Ibn Sam Ibn Noah, who were Arabs living in Al Ahqaf in Yemen between Oman and Hadramaut, on a land called Ashar stretching out into the sea. The name of their valley was Mughiith

Some traditions claimed that Hud (PBUH) was the first person who spoke Arabic while others claimed that Noah (PBUH) was the first. It was also said that Adam was the first.

Hud (PBUH) condemned idol worship and admonished his people. “MY people, what is the benefit of these stones that you carve with your own hands and worship? In reality it is an insult to the intellect. There is only One Deity worthy of worship and that is Allah. Worship of Him and Him alone, is compulsory on you.

He created you, He provides for you and He is the One Who will cause you to die. He gave you wonderful physiques and blessed you in many ways. So believe in Him and do not be blind to His favors, or the same fate that destroyed Noah’s people will overtake you.”

With such reasoning Hud hoped to instill faith in them, but they refused to accept his message. His people asked him: “Do you desire to be our master with your call? What payment do you want?”

Hud tried to make them understand that he would receive his payment (reward) from Allah; he did not demand anything from them except that they let the light of truth touch their minds and hearts.

Allah the Almighty states: And to Ad people We sent their brother Hud. He said: “O my people! Worship Allah! You have no other Ilah (god) but Him; Certainly, you do nothing but invent (lies)! O my people I ask of you no reward for it (the Message). My reward is only from Him Who created me. Will you not then understand? And O my people! Ask forgiveness of your Lord and then repent to Him, He will send you (from the sky) abundant rain, and add strength to your strength, so do not turn away as Mujrimeen (criminals, disbeliveers in the Oneness of Allah).”

They said: “O Hud! No evidence have you brought us and we shall not leave our gods for your mere saying! We are not believers in you. All that we say is that some of our gods (false deities) have seized you with evil (madness).”

HE said: “I call Allah to witness and bear you witness that I am free from that which you ascribe as partners in worship, and with Him (Allah). SO plot against me, all of you, and give me no respite. I put my trust in Allah, my Lord and your Lord! There is not a moving (living) creature but HE has grasp of its forelock. Verily, my Lord is on the Straight Path (the truth). SO if you turn away, still I have conveyed the Message with which I was sent to you. My Lord will make another people succeed you, and you will not harm Him in the least. Surely, my Lord is Guardian over all things.” (Ch 11:50-57 Quran)

]]>

Hud tried to speak to them and to explain about Allah’s blessings: how Allah the Almighty had made them Noah’s successors, how He had given them strength and power, and how HE sent them rain to revive the soil.

Hud’s people looked about them and found they were the strongest on earth, so they become prouder and more obstinate. Thus they argued a lot with Hud. They asked “O Hud! Do you say that later we die and turn into dust, we will be resurrected?” He replied, “Yes, you will come back on the Day of Judgment and each of you will be asked about what you did.”

A peal of laughter was heard after the last statement. “How strange Hud’s claims are!” The disbeliveers muttered among themselves. They believed that when man dies his body decays and turns into dust, which is swept away by the wind. How could that return to its original state? Then what is the significance of the Day of Judgment? Why does the dead return to life?

All these questions were patiently received by Hud. He then addressed his people concerning the Day of Judgment. he explained that belief in the Day of Judgment is essential to Allah’s justice, teaching them the same thing that every prophet taught about it.

Hud explained that justice demands that there be a Day of Judgment because good is not always victorious in life. Sometimes evil overpowers good. Will such crimes go unpunished? If we suppose there is no Day of Judgment, then a great injustice will have prevailed, but Allah has forbidden injustice to be incurred by Himself or His subjects. Therefore, the existence of the Day of Judgment, a day of accounting for our deeds and being rewarded or punished for them, reveals the extend of Allah’s justice. Hud spoke to them about all of these things. They listened but disbelieved him.

Allah recounts his people’s attitude towards the Day of Judgment: ”The chiefs of his people, whom disbelieved and denied the meeting in the Hereafter, and to who We had given the luxuries and comforts of this life, said: “He is no more than a human being like you, he eats of that which you eat, and drinks of what you drink. If you were to obey a human being like yourselves then verily! You indeed would be losers. Does he promise you that when you have died and have become dust and bones, you shall come out alive (resurrected)? Far, very far, is that which you are promised. There is nothing but our life of this world! We die and we live! We are not going to be resurrected! He is only a man who has invented a lie against Allah, but we are not going to believe in him.” (Ch 23:33-38 Quran)

the chiefs of Hud’s people asked: “IS it not strange that Allah’s chooses one of us to reveal His message to?”

Hud replied: “What is strange in that? Allah wants to guide you to the right way of life, so HE sent me to warn you. Noah’s flood and his story are not far away from you, so do not forget what happened. All the disbeliveers were destroyed, no matter how strong they were.”

“Who is going to destroy us Hud?” the chiefs asked.

“Allah.” replied Hud.

The disbeliveers among his people answered: “We will be saved by our gods.”

Hud clarified to them that the gods they worshipped would be the reason for their destruction, that it is Allah alone Who saves people, and that no other power on earth can benefit or harm anyone.

The conflict between Hud and his people continued. The years passed, and they became prouder and more obstinate, and more tyrannical and more defiant of their prophet’s message.

Furthermore, they started to accuse Hud (PBUH) of being a crazy lunatic. One day they told him: “We now understand the secret of your madness you insulted our gods and they harmed you; that is why you have become insane.”

Almighty Allah repeated their words in the Quran: “O my Hud! No evidence have you brought us, and we shall not leave our gods for your mere saying! And we are not believers in you. All that we say is that some of our gods (false deities) have seized you with evil (madness).” (Ch 11:53-54 Quran)

Hud had to return their challenge. He had no other way but to turn to Allah alone, no other alternative but to give them a threatening ultimatum. he declared to them: “I call Allah to witness and bear you witness that I am free from that which you ascribe as pin worship with Him (Allah). SO plot against me, all of you and give me no respite. I put my trust in Allah, my Lord your Lord! There is not a moving (living) creature but He has grasp of its forelock. Verily, my Lord is on the Straight Path (the truth). So if you turn away, still I have conveyed the message with which it was sent to you. My Lord will make another people succeed you, and you will not harm Him.” (Ch 11:54-57 Quran)

Thus Hud renounced them and their gods and affirmed his dependence on Allah Who had created him. Hud realized that punishment would be incurred on the disbeliveers among his people. It is one of the laws of life. Allah punishes the disbeliveers, no matter how rich, tyrannical or great they are.

Hud and his people waited for Allah’s promise. A drought spread throughout the land, for the sky no longer sent its rain. the sun scorched the desert sands, looking like a disk of fire which settled on people’s heads.

Hud’s people hastened to him asking: “What is that drought Hud?”

Hud answered: “Allah is angry with you. If you believe in Him, He will accept you and the rain will fall and you will become stronger than you are.”

They mocked him and became more obstinate, sarcastic and preserve in their unbelief. The drought increased, the trees turned yellow, and plants died.

A day came when they found the sky full of clouds. Hud’s people were glad as they came out of their tents crying: “A cloud, which will give us rain!”

The weather changed suddenly from burning dry and hot to stinging cold with wind that shook everything; trees, plants, tents, men and women. The wind increased day after day and night after night.

Hud’s people started to flee. They ran to their tents to hide but the gale became stronger, ripping their tents from their stakes. They hid under cloth covers but the gale became stronger and still and tore away the covers. It slashed clothing and skin. It penetrated the apertures of the body and destroyed it. It hardly touched anything before it was destroyed or killed, its core sucked out to decompose and rot. The storm raged for 8 days and 7 nights.

Almighty Allah recounts: Then when they saw it as a dense cloud coming towards their valleys, they said: “This is a cloud bringing us rain!” Nay but it is that torment which you were asking to be hastened! a wind wherein is a painful torment! Destroying everything by the command of its Lord! (Ch 46:24-25 Quran)

Allah the Exalted described it thus: And as for Ad, they were destroyed for a firious violent wind which Allah imposed on them for 7 nights and 8 days in succession, so that you could see men lying overthrown (destroyed) as if they were hollow trunks of palm trees! (Ch 69:6-7 Quran)

That violent gale did not stop until the entire region was reduced to ruins and its wicked people destroyed, swallowed by the sands of the desert. Only Hud and his followers remained unharmed. They migrated to Hadramaut and lived there in peace, worshipping Allah, their true Lord.

Buying your first home can be a time of excitement but also one that can be quite worrying as there is a lot of expense that is involved. Many first-time buyers find it difficult to get on the property ladder, but first-time buyers in Australia are now able to take advantage of the first home owners grant which was introduced on 1 July 2000. The first home owners grant can be up to ,000 if you are a first time buyer who wants to buy a house has already been built or up to ,000 if you are building your own home or buying a new build home. However these rates do vary that is a good idea to check with your local state revenue office to see what the latest rates are.

Obviously the first home owners grant is a massive help to anyone who is looking to buy their own home but needs a little extra capital to help them to do so. For instance if you are eligible a first home owners grant you can use this to pay off part of the value of your home, which will then make your monthly mortgage repayments quite a bit smaller. Or you could use it to go towards other costs involved with your new home such as building inspections, legal fees, stamp duty or any other costs incurred with buying your new home.

In order to be eligible for one of the first home owners grant payments you need to have never applied for a first home owners grant previously. You also need to prove that neither you nor anyone else who is applying for a first home owners grant has ever owned a home before, as these payments are only available for first home owners. In addition at least one of the owners who is applying for a first home owners grant needs to be a natural Australian citizen otherwise the application will be turned down as you would not meet the eligibility criteria.

To apply for a first home owners grant you will need to fill in an application form and this needs to be sent back to the state revenue office in which you are planning on buying your new first home. It is also a good idea to know that a first home owners grant can be applied for for any type of dwelling which is classed as a residence that this can be a flat, a townhouse, a duplex or a single dwelling etc. However to meet the criteria for a first home owners grant the dwelling must be connected via land to sewerage and water services otherwise it will not be eligible for the grant. This means that houseboats and caravans are excluded from the first home owners grant scheme.
